The Sunday morning talk shows - a preview
For Sunday, February 17, 2008

FOX News Sunday (FNS): Host Chris Wallace chats with Director of National Intelligence Mike McConnell about FISA. Then he turns to Obama guy Jim Doyle of Wisconsin and Clinton-dude and Ted Strickland of Ohio.
Meet the Press (NBC): Tim Russert hosts a Dem argument between Clinton supporter Chuck Schumer and Obama guy Dick Durbin.
This Week (ABC): Host George Stephanopoulos talks to Republican Presidential near-nominee John McCain.
Face the Nation (CBS): Host Bob Schieffer chats it up with Obama strategist David Axelrod; Howard Wolfson of the ever-changing Hillary campaign; Obama Surrogate Doug Wilder of Richmond; and Hillary surrogate Antonio Villaraigosa of Los Angeles.
Late Edition (CNN): Host Wolf Blitzer talks to Louisiana Governor Bobby Jindall.
